Respirator selection and use should be based on contaminant type, form and concentration. Follow applicable
regulations and good Industrial Hygiene practice.
Skin protection: Impervious gloves are recommended for prolonged skin contact.
Eye/face protection: Safety glasses or goggles are recommended if splashing is possible.
Other: Appropriate protective clothing as needed to minimize skin contact. Suitable washing facilities should
be available in the work area.

Section 10. STABILITY AND REACTIVITY
Reactivity: Not expected to be reactive.
Chemical stability: Stable.
Possibility of hazardous reactions: None known.
Conditions to avoid: Avoid extremely high or low temperatures.
Incompatible materials: None known.
Hazardous decomposition products: Thermal decomposition may produce oxides of carbon and potassium.
Section 11. TOXICOLOGICAL INFORMATION
Inhalation: High concentrations of mists may cause nose, throat, and upper respiratory tract irritation.
Ingestion: Swallowing large amounts may cause gastrointestinal irritating and nausea.
Skin contact: Prolonged skin contact may cause irritation with redness and itching.
Eye contact: Direct contact may cause minor eye irritation with redness, tearing and pain.
Chronic effects: None known.
Reproductive Toxicity: None of the components have been shown to cause reproductive or developmental
toxicity.
Mutagenicity: None of the components have been shown to cause mutagenic activity.
Carcinogenicity: None of the ingredients are listed as a carcinogen by IARC, NTP or OSHA.
